#2c4179 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c4179 is composed of 17.3% red, 25.5%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.6% cyan, 46.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 223.6 degrees, a saturation of 46.7% and a lightness of 32.4%. #2c4179 color hex could be obtained by blending #5882f2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#2c4179 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#2c4179 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2c4179 has RGB values of R:44, G:65,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 2900345.

Shades and Tints of #2c4179
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020306 is the darkest color, while #f7f8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#2c4179
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#525253 is the less saturated color, while #06309f is the most saturated one.
